This handbook documents the comprehensive evaluation and training system that is being used with Indiana's adult basic education programs. It consists of a set of instruments to assess the effectiveness of ABE programs and a series of workshops to train program providers to carry out the evaluation. Two introductory sections contain a guide to the evaluation handbook and a materials list. The guide describes in detail the contents of each of the five major sections that follow. The five major sections are based on the workshops that are used to train program directors in self-evaluation and to train ABE teachers to evaluate their own paired program. Section I contains materials for the preliminary meeting--an outline of Indiana's evaluation model that includes a rationale, a timetable, and an appendix. Section II provides materials for a workshop on program self-evaluation, including a guide for directors and all instruments. Section III contains materials for a workshop on formative and summative evaluation and provides all the materials and methods evaluators will use to gather data. Section IV presents materials for a workshop on writing the formative report and guidelines and form for conducting classroom observations. Section V contains the workshop packet that provides examples of coding learner data and writing a summative report. (YLB)
